大二上学期周总结

这周主要学习了JavaBean,Servlet,Jsp管理状态等的一些基本内容:

JavaBean:了解到javabean就是用java编写的运行在web上的组件,如同java一样。

javabean可以向java类一样创建一个实例,不过要导入。也可以使用jsp动作标签。

<jsp:useBean id="标识符" class="java全类名" scope="作用范围"/>实例化javaBean对象。

<jsp:setProperty name="javvaBean实例名(与上面的id同名)" property="*"(表示使用上个页面传进来的参数) />

JSP管理状态:

学习了保存用户状态的两种机制 1,session,2,Cookie。主要学习了Cookie。

Cookie就是web服务器保存在客户端的一系列文本信息。

在JSP中创建使用Cookie:在java中使用Cookie newcookie=new Cookie(String key,Object value)用键值的方式创建Cookie

在使用respons.addCookie(newcookie)写入,使用Cookie[] cookies=request.getCookie()读取。

Servlet:

Servlet是纯java文件是一个类,运行在Servlet容器中,它可以 1.创建并返回客户请求的动态页面,2.与数据库进行访问。

使用Servlet我们首先要定义一个类实现Servlet接口,重写service方法,用于处理客户请求。

但是Servlet不可直接访问,要在web.xml中添加映射。

原文地址:https://www.cnblogs.com/fengchuiguobanxia/p/13910998.html